Yokohama FC Secures Narrow Victory in Kobe Match
Kobe, Japan – Despite Vissel Kobe dominating possession (62%), Yokohama FC managed to secure a narrow victory with a late goal in the 90th minute. The match, part of the J1 League’s Round 26 and played at the NOEVIR Stadium Kobe, was officiated by Akihiko Ikeuchi.
Despite their territorial dominance and more goal-scoring opportunities (16 total shots, compared to Yokohama FC’s 5), Vissel Kobe failed to convert their chances. Only 3 of their 16 shots were on target. Yokohama FC, on the other hand, proved more effective, although they only managed one shot on target, which ultimately resulted in S. Ito’s winning goal, assisted by S. Sakuragawa, who had previously received a yellow card.
The match was characterized by intense play, with a total of 22 fouls committed (9 by Vissel Kobe and 13 by Yokohama FC) and three yellow cards shown: one to H. Ide of Vissel Kobe, and two to H. Ogura and S. Sakuragawa of Yokohama FC. Although Vissel Kobe generated more corners (5 compared to 3), they could not capitalize on them on the scoreboard. Yokohama FC, with a ball possession of 38%, demonstrated effectiveness and defensive solidity to maintain the result until the end.
